Color   Current strength in amps(ATO/MINI)  Current strength in amps(JCASE)  
Light brown   5   —  
Brown   7.5   —  
Red   10   50  
Blue   15   20  
Yellow   20   60  
White or clear  25   —

  WARNING 
Improper replacement of burned out headlights and other light bulbs can cause serious per-sonal injury.

  WARNING 
Failure to heed warning lights and instrument cluster text messages can cause the vehicle to break down in traffic and result in a collision and serious personal injury.
